First, I'll show you different ways to take pictures on this phone now. The basic way or the most intuitive way is to simply press the shutter button. But, besides that, we have many other things to do as well, so for that go to settings, scroll down a bit, select shooting modes or shooting methods, and these are all the different things that we have show's. We have press volume to take picture so just in the preview window or in the camera application just press the volume down button to take a picture. Now, this little shortcut will be really handy while taking selfies.

Next we have floating shutter button, so once you enable it, you will see a floating button on the preview screen, and you can click this button over here. Instead of taking it over here to take a picture now, a very quick shortcut, you can also swipe the shutter button around, and you can also pull it back to the original shutter button to hide it, or else you can also swipe it from here to bring back the floating button. This is once again super handy while taking selfies like this, perhaps so, just click it over here to take a picture and when you're done swipe it back, and it goes back there you go next. We have tap screen so using this feature, you can take selfies by just touching the preview screen, so it doesn't work for the real camera, but it does work for selfies. So here's the front-facing camera not touch the screen to take a picture, so that was pretty awkward anyway.

Next we have the palm gesture. So this is where you can enable it show palm now, once you're done, you can simply show your palm to your phone like that to take a picture in two seconds or probably more, and you can probably see a small preview near the front camera over here when it works there you go so in that way, we can once again take selfies much easy v just by using a gesture. So these are all the different shooting methods that you should definitely check out personally, I like the palm one. How do you split screen mode on this phone now split, screen mode is a feature that allows you to use two applications at the same time. So normally you can present all the recent apps button to do that, but it doesn't work on this phone. So if you want to use split screen mode first, you need to go to the recent apps page. First, click, the app icon that you want to use in split screen mode like this now select open in split screen view.

Once you do that that application will open up in a top window, and now you can save in the application from the list over here or else you can go to the home screen and then select it from here that you have draw now I'm just going to open YouTube, and now we can use two applications. At the same time now still screen mode has been on android for a very long time, but still there are applications that do not support it. So if you want to make sure that all the application supports split screen mode, this is what you need to do. Go to settings and then scroll to the bottom. Select about phone now.

Select software information. Now click on the build number seven times once you do that, you will be asked for the password just enter that and once you're done developer options will be enabled you can find them in settings at the bottom. Now, once you open it up scroll all the way to the bottom and make sure you enable post activities to be resizable, and they start your phone once you do that, you should be able to use all the applications in the split screen mode now going on next I'll show you some super handy shortcuts for your default launcher, I'm, pretty sure it's Samsung launcher anyway. So this is a piece that you need to come to change your default applications now going on next I'll show you how to display the battery percentage on the status bar for that once again go to settings now.

Select notifications then select status bar and enable the toggle that says show battery percentage once you do that by Triple, H will be visible on the status bar. This is something you should definitely do now before. I conclude, I will show you one of the best features available on any Samsung phone. That's ultra power saving mode. So to enable that you need to go to settings, then select device care, then select battery, and from this place you can turn on ultimate power, saving mood or maximum power saving more you can just do that and click apply, and then your phone will turn on the maximum power saving mode.

Now, once it turns on this feature, these are the things that happen on your phone. Brightness goes down, CPU performance is limited, all the applications will be killed, and you will be given access to only these six applications. First for our fix, Peruvian select rest of the applications, and you can just do that and select all the applications that you want me to like most essential for you. You can also use Wi-Fi and mobile data by using this mode. Now, let's say your phone has just 5 or 10% of battery left, and you don't want your phone to shut down.

You still want to use your phone, maybe for one or two hours more than just by enabling this maximum power, saving mode standby time and screen time will improve significantly on your phone. So this is something you should definitely check out and to exit it.
